No-Pectin Plum Jam

A delightful homemade plum jam that captures the sweet essence of ripe plums without the use of pectin, perfect for any occasion.

Ingredients
  

Key Ingredients
  • 10 cups Chopped Plums About 4 lbs. of ripe, juicy plums.
  • 5 cups Sugar Adjustable based on preference.
  • Optional Add-Ins: Chia seeds or monk fruit sweetener For alternative sweetness and texture.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Wash and pit the plums, then chop them into small pieces and let them sit for 30 minutes to release their juices.
Mixing
  1. In a heavy-bottomed pot or Instant Pot, pour in the chopped plums and the measured sugar. Stir until well combined and let sit for a while.
Cooking
  1. For stovetop, cook over medium heat, stirring continuously until the mixture reaches a rolling boil (about 10-15 minutes).
  2. For Instant Pot, set to manual for 5 minutes and allow natural pressure release afterward.
Finishing Touch
  1. Check the consistency of the jam using the spoon drip test; it should coat the back of the spoon.
  2. Once cooled, transfer the jam into sterilized jars and seal while warm.

Notes

To enhance nutritional content, consider using monk fruit instead of refined sugar and adding chia seeds for fiber. Store jars in a cool, dark place for long shelf life.
